An isolated environment in a multi-cloud platform means each workload runs in its own protected zone, free from noisy neighbors, rogue processes, or risky cross-traffic. This separation isn’t just good for security. It’s critical for predictable performance. Systems scale cleanly. Failures stay contained. Resource limits are enforced. Debugging gets easier when environments have clear, impenetrable boundaries.
